Bitrate is arguably more important than resolution. It measures the amount of data used to encode each second of video and is measured in kilobits per second (kbps). A high bitrate preserves complex textures, fast motion, and subtle color gradients. A low bitrate leads to compression artifacts like blockiness, blurring, and banding (visible lines in smooth gradients like the sky).

Instead of applying the same data rate to every second of a film, modern encoding dynamically assigns more data to fast-moving action scenes and less to static dialogue scenes.
